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Choice: The type of paving material, such as concrete, asphalt, or pavers, significantly impacts the overall cost.
- Labor Rates: Labor costs in San Clemente can vary, influencing the total expense of the project.
- Footpath Size and Length: Larger or longer footpaths require more materials and labor, increasing the cost.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the site, including grading and soil preparation, can affect the cost.
- Permits and Regulations: Local permits and adherence to city regulations may add to the overall expense.
- Design Complexity: More intricate designs or custom elements can raise the cost.
- Accessibility: Easy access to the site can reduce costs, while difficult-to-reach areas may increase them.

| Task | Average Cost (San Clemente, CA) |
|---|---|
| Concrete Footpath (per sq. ft.) | $8 - $12 |
| Asphalt Footpath (per sq. ft.) | $5 - $9 |
| Paver Footpath (per sq. ft.) | $10 - $20 |
| Excavation and Grading (per sq. ft.) | $2 - $4 |
| Site Preparation (per sq. ft.) | $1 - $3 |
|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
| Design and Planning Services | $500 - $2,000 |
